Regular Manual QA Engineer
Project Description:
Провідна міжнародна ІТ-компанія шукає тестувальника на проекти, пов'язані з автоматизацією процесів та платежів провідного банку України. Ми пропонуємо цікаві та масштабні проекти, що базуються на сучасних технологіях, роботу в складі високопрофесійного колективу.
Responsibilities:
• Забезпечення необхідного рівня якості ПЗ шляхом організації та проведення тестування відповідно до стандартів якості.
• Планування процесу тестування, включно з вибором методологій, підходів та інструментів для забезпечення якості.
• Розробка дизайну сценаріїв тестування для перевірки функціоналу, безпеки, продуктивності та інших аспектів ПЗ.
• Виконання всіх видів тестування ПЗ, включно з функціональним, регресійним, навантажувальним, інтеграційним та приймальним тестуванням.
• Керування дефектами в проєкті: реєстрація, аналіз, відстеження та координація виправлення дефектів.
• Взаємодія з усіма учасниками процесу розробки ПЗ, включаючи розробників, аналітиків і менеджерів проєкту, для ефективного тестування та вирішення проблем.
• Підтримка приймального тестування, забезпечення виконання всіх умов для успішного переходу продукту на стадію релізу.
• Розробка тестової документації, підготовка звітності про результати тестування та надання рекомендацій щодо покращення якості.
• Постановка завдань для автоматизації тестування та розробка сценаріїв автоматизації для підвищення ефективності тестування.Mandatory Skills Description:
• Досвід роботи від 4-х років
• Здатність планувати робочий процес як для індивідуального виконання завдань, так і в командній роботі
• Глибокі знання видів тестування (функціональне, регресійне, навантажувальне, інтеграційне та ін.) та навички їх реалізації.
• Навички роботи з системами таск-трекінгу (Jira або інші) та вміння складати якісні звіти.
• Вміння працювати з SQL: створювати, оптимізувати та перевіряти складні SQL-запити для роботи з базами даних.
• Знання SDLC (Software Development Life Cycle) та досвід роботи в рамках різних етапів життєвого циклу розробки ПЗ.
• Досвід роботи з проєктною документацією та логами: навички створення та підтримки тестових артефактів (тест-планів, тест-кейсів, чек-листів).
• Знання архітектури клієнт-сервер і мікросервісів; розуміння основних протоколів стека TCP/IP та принципів їх взаємодії.
• Знання Linux на рівні базових команд для аналізу логів та роботи з тестовим середовищем.
• Досвід роботи з API: знання реалізації протоколів SOAP і RESTful-архітектури, навички тестування API за допомогою Postman або аналогічних інструментів.
• Розуміння навантажувального тестування та досвід роботи з інструментами, такими як Apache JMeter або його аналогами.
• Розуміння концепції CI/CD: досвід роботи з Jenkins, а також з інструментами моніторингу та управління, такими як Kibana, Confluence, DBeaver, Jira, TestRail.
• Досвід роботи з WSO2 ESB, WSO2 EI, WSO2 MI, Tomcat, Camunda — перевага для роботи з інтеграційними процесами.Nice-to-Have Skills Description:
• Знання основних принципів безпеки для виявлення можливих вразливостей у програмному забезпеченні.
• Досвід роботи з хмарними середовищами (Google Cloud, AWS, Azure) для тестування хмарних інтеграційних рішень.
• Розуміння контейнеризації та роботи з Docker для налаштування тестових середовищ.- Languages:
- English: A1 Beginner
- Ukrainian: C1 Advanced